The Winchester Town Advisory Board on July 8 approved a vacation of easements and a design review to allow Highland LLC to build a 1.23-acre electric-vehicle charging parking lot north of Capella Avenue and west of Highland Drive. Staff recommended approval; a nearby property owner asked about the exact site location during public comment.

The Winchester Town Advisory Board approved two companion planning items July 8 allowing Highland LLC to vacate easements along Highland Drive and build a 1.23-acre electric-vehicle parking lot north of Capella Avenue and west of Highland Drive.

Jennifer Lazovich, representing the applicant, said the site is master-planned for business employment and located in an industrial light zone and described covered parking, an on-site operations building and gated access.
